Designed for Pulse Width Modulated (PWM) current control of low voltage stepper motors, the A3965S is capable of output currents to ± 500 mA and operating voltages to 20 V.
The A3965 is particularly attractive for low power or battery operated motors where minimal power consumption is desired. A SLEEP mode disables all circuitry and typically draws less than 1A supply current from motor and logic supply. During operation the fixed frequency ON pulses of each H-bridge are 180 degrees out of phase to minimize the peak demand required of the motor supply allowing savings in size and cost of external power supply components.
